3056858727_ce1f6b6f02Litopia After Dark this week is plunging further into the murky depths of the literary world than we have ever been before, as we deliberate the question – Vice: is it any good?

We look at the sin of shoplifting books, the evil-doing of downloading e-books and the depravity of failing to return library books. And as we plummet, the panel discuss literally pitching your work and the wrath that may result… the sloth of Thesaurus use… the lust of the madam memoir.

By the time we’ve settled at the bottom of the pit, all that remains is the question of literary vice – naughty or nice?

The deviant panellists this week are Dave Bartram, Donna Ballman and Eve Harvey. And you should have been in the chatroom at 8pm GMT on Friday, it was wicked!
